Subject: Parity check — Ferngate SDKs before Thursday's cut

Hey release folks,

Quick heads-up before you stamp the Ferngate release: the Swift and Kotlin SDKs are finally at parity on the retry and offline-queue APIs. The one gap left is batch uploads, which Kotlin has and Swift lands next sprint — release notes should call that out so nobody assumes otherwise. Otherwise the surface matches, and the contract tests pass on both. Dru ran the parity suite this morning against the build stamped below.

pipeline stamp: htk4_a42b

## Add per-tenant rate limiting to Gatewright

This PR wires token-bucket rate limiting into the Gatewright internal gateway, keyed on tenant ID instead of raw client IP. Heavy hitters like the Mossbeam batch jobs were starving interactive traffic, so buckets now refill independently per tenant with a shared burst allowance. Responses over the limit return 429 with a retry hint header. Rollout is behind the `gw_tenant_limits` flag, default off, so this should be safe for Thursday's train. The limiter ships with these defaults.

tuning constants:
QUOTAS = {
    "druwyn": 5,
    "holix": 5,
    "zorath": 5,
    "holwyn": 10,
}

Handover — wiki RBAC (for eng sync)

Took over Quillpad role-based access from Dena's team. Editor/viewer split is live; admin role migration is half done. Known issue: group sync lags up to an hour, so new hires see read-only at first. No open incidents. Before touching anything, note that the access service currently runs with these configuration values.

config for bawig-fadup:
[zorix]
host = zorix.lumicworks.corp
user = zorix_svc
database = zorix_prod

## Onboarding: Rowanstage Seat-Map Renderer

The Rowanstage renderer produces interactive seat maps for the Alder Hall theatre box office. Reviewers should note that seat availability data is signed at the edge, and the renderer refuses unsigned payloads. Access to the staging signer is deliberately constrained: it lives on a single hardened host with no remote login. To initialize a review session on that host, enter the passphrase given below.

vault phrase of fahog-yajof = istael-zorwyn